Noun [Cebuano]

Etymology: From chocnut, blend of chocolate + peanut. Alternatively from chocolate + coconut, since supposedly the original recipe used chocolate and coconut. Head templates: {{head|ceb|noun}} tsoknat
  1. a confectionery, usually sold in small bars, made with cocoa powder, peanuts and sugar
